Maurten continues to introduce cutting-edge fuel options, but they are perhaps best known for their Hydrogel Technology. What does that mean? Here is the breakdown to help you determine if Maurten could be an option for you:

Maurten's Hydrogel:

      Encapsulates carbohydrates to carry them through the stomach - so they can be absorbed and used by the body faster.

      Makes sports fuel easier to tolerate during high-intensity exercise.

      Enables athletes to consume more carbohydrates per hour and sustain performance without stress in the stomach

      Doesn't contain any added colors, preservatives, or flavors, which means less to irritate your gut.

      Comes from only natural ingredients, specifically alginate - extracted from the cell walls of brown algae - and pectin - found in apples, lemons, carrots, and tomatoes.

The overall takeaway? Improved comfort and more carbs = better results in training and racing!

You can find Maurten's Hydrogel Technology in their Gel 100, Gel 100 Caf 100, and Gel 160. The numbers indicate the number of calories (and caffeine where applicable) in each packet.
